- Description
- Predicted to be involved in mitochondrion organization; protein retention in Golgi apparatus; and protein targeting to vacuole. Human ortholog(s) of this gene implicated in Parkinson's disease 23. Orthologous to human VPS13C (vacuolar protein sorting 13 homolog C).
